Litecoin is in a position where we could have seen the low of wave II and the next impulsive rally could start anytime for a move towards the 121 - 122 area. That said, it's also possible that wave II only just completed wave b of II and wave c lower to 76.11 now is in progress. The final outcome is still more upside, but the big question is from where. We have to remember that we are in wave 3 and correction during this wave tends to be smaller in size and duration. So, it should come as no surprise if Litecoin starts to rally higher anytime now towards the next big upside target at 121.
